Java SSH框架在Java Web中的应用
Java SSH框架是Java Web开发的常见技术框架集合,包含Struts、Hibernate和Spring三三个框架,这三个框架在具体开发应用侧重点都有所不同,各自管理的代码范围也有着较大的区别。当前应用SSH框架集进行Java Web项目的开发是Web开发过程中非常流行的开发模式。
SSH框架在Java Web中的应用可以分为三个方面:Struts框架的具体应用过程、Hibernate框架的具体应用过程和Spring框架的具体应用过程。
Struts框架的具体应用过程:
Struts框架是一个基于MVC模式的Web应用框架,它提供了一个灵活的框架来开发Web应用程序。Struts框架的具体应用过程可以分为三个步骤:首先是Struts.xml文件的配置,Struts框架通过“包”的形式来管理各类Action和拦截器,其次是在配置好Struts.xml后需要进行相关Action类的定义,Action类通常继承ActionSupport类,然后定义好相关JSP资源和请求结果的映射关系。
Hibernate框架的具体应用过程:
Hibernate框架是一个基于ORM(Object-Relational Mapping)的持久层框架,它提供了一个灵活的框架来开发Java应用程序。Hibernate框架的具体应用过程可以分为三个步骤:首先是配置hibernate.cfg.xml文件,然后是定义实体类和映射文件,最后是使用Hibernate API来实现数据的持久化和查询。
Spring框架的具体应用过程:
Spring框架是一个基于IoC(Inversion of Control)和AOP(Aspect-Oriented Programming)的轻量级框架,它提供了一个灵活的框架来开发Java应用程序。Spring框架的具体应用过程可以分为三个步骤:首先是配置Spring的Bean容器,然后是定义Service层和DAO层,最后是使用Spring的AOP来实现业务逻辑的分离。
SSH框架在Java Web中的应用可以分为三个方面,分别是Struts框架、Hibernate框架和Spring框架,这三个框架在具体开发应用侧重点都有所不同,各自管理的代码范围也有着较大的区别。